“My father, King Qin Guang, is named Jiang Ziwen, head of the ten Kings of Hell who rule the underworld.

He presides over the First Palace, responsible for recording the fates and deaths of mortals, guiding rebirth, and overseeing good and evil in the netherworld. His Judgment Palace lies beyond the Great Sea, to the west along the Black Road of the Yellow Springs.

He governs the length of human life; each person’s deeds are reported by city gods, earth spirits, and inspectors to the palace, where my father personally judges. Those whose good and bad deeds are balanced are spared punishment and sent directly to the tenth palace, or reborn according to their merits—as male or female, rich or poor, to fulfill their karmic consequences. The deeply sinful are dispatched to various hells to endure torment and cleanse their sins.

On the day a virtuous soul’s life ends, it is guided to rebirth. Those whose merits are balanced are sent to the tenth palace, to be reborn—perhaps male to female, or vice versa, their fortunes measured to settle past grievances.

Those with more evil than good are brought to the right platform in the palace, called the Mirror of Retribution. The platform is three meters high, the mirror ten spans wide, hanging to the east with seven characters atop: ‘No good soul before the Mirror of Retribution.’

The souls of the wicked see their own sinister hearts reflected and realize then that all the gold in life cannot be carried along, that only their sins remain. After passing the mirror, they are sent to the second palace for punishment in hell.”
